A group of sentient warring robots crash-lands on Earth four million years ago. When they awake in the present day, their battle begins anew.

Synopsis

The Transformers are a race of sentient robots from the planet Cybertron. They have been involved in a eons-old war between the heroic Autobots and the evil Decepticons. In an effort the save their home planet from destruction as it passes through an asteroid field, the Autobots lead a mission into space to clear a path through the asteroids. After the mission is completed, the Decepticons attack the weakened Autobot warriors. In a desperate effort to defeat the Decepticons, Optimus Prime, the Autobot leader, crash lands the Autobot spaceship, called the Ark, into the (believed to be) lifeless planet nearby. Four million years later, the Transformers are awakened to discover that this planet (Earth), is not so lifeless after all. The war begins anew....

Note: chronologically, the UK Annual stories "State Games" and "And There Shall Come...a Leader!" are set during the early events of this issue.

Credits

Plot: Bill Mantlo
Script: Ralph Macchio
Pencils: Frank Springer
Inks: Kim DeMulder
Colors: Nelson Yomtov
Lettering: Higgins and Rick Parker
Editor: Bob Budiansky

  • Originally published: unknown (Cover date: September 1984)

Items of note

  • Advertised as part 1 in a 4-issue limited series.
  • Printed on high-quality Mando paper.
  • On May 22, the first Usenet post about Transformers is posted by Ted Nolan to net.comics, regarding this issue. Capsule review? "Worst comic of the year."
  • The cover price is 75 cents, which would be $1.50 when adjusted for inflation to 2007 dollars. In November, 2007, IDW Publishing's Transformers comics currently cost $3.99.

  • U.S. cover: Gigantic Optimus Prime, tiny Starscream, Gears, Laserbeak and the Witwickys by Bill Sienkiewicz.
  • UK issue 1 cover: Soundwave and Buzzsaw kick Prime's ass by Jerry Paris.
  • UK issue 2 cover: The Autobots depart the Ark by John Ridgway.
